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Lelant Saltings to Hatfield & Stainforth start from as little as £56.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lelant Saltings to Hatfield & Stainforth start from £129.30 one way, or £220.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lelant Saltings to Hatfield & Stainforth are available for £243.10 one way, or £486.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Lelant Saltings

Lelant Saltings might not boast all the amenities of a major hub, but it provides essential services for travelers. The station does not have a ticket office or machines, meaning tickets should be purchased online ahead of your journey. While the absence of wa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ities might deter some, those seeking a simple and straightforward travel experience will appreciate its essentialist approach.

For those requiring assistance, there are help points available, and an induction loop is provided for those with hearing aids. While step-free access facilitates mobility, it's important to note that access involves a short steep ramp. If you're planning an automobile arrival, a spacious council-managed car park is nearby, offering free parking throughout the week. Travelers can also find some seating areas to rest while waiting for their train.

Facilities and Amenities

Though small, Hatfield & Stainforth train station provides ess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. These machines are accessible, ensuring ease of use for all passengers. An induction loop is also in place, accommodating those with hearing impairments.

The station is categorized as an 'A' grade for accessibility, offering step-free access across the site. This includes a ramped footbridge for easy platform transitions. Unfortunately, other facilities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ment points are not available, so travelers should plan accordingly. Free parking is available with 15 spaces on-site, although there are no dedicated accessible parking spaces.

Connectivity and Transport Links

Hatfield & Stainforth station is well-positioned for onward travel. While there are no nearby bus services, convenient rail replacement services are available with bus stops on Station Road for travel towards Scunthorpe and Doncaster. Although there are no direct bicycle hire opportunities, travelers can plan transfers using available taxi services by visiting Northern’s cab booking service.

For those planning to extend their journey beyond the station, comprehensive options are facilitated via local taxis. However, do note that there are no cycling facilities such as sheltered bike storage or bicycle hire services at the station.
